Welcome to Growing Places Nursery in Gourock

Growing Places Nursery welcomes children from 6 weeks to school age. We are in Partnership with the Local council. Our capacity is 24 children per day.

The nursery is situated just off Shore Street Gourock, offering easy access to public transport, e.g. bus, ferry, and train. Collecting and dropping off by car is also favourable.

Both indoor and outdoor play will be encouraged, as through this your child will be able to develop in all aspects of their lives.

We will be having our Care Commission Inspection soon for this year. They are introducing a new Grading System. They will now award grades based on the quality of the care our service provides. The Care Commission will grade services and publish those grades as part of fulfilling its duty in terms of section 4(1) of the Regulation of Care (Scotland) act 2001 to provide information to the public about the quality of care services.

We must involve our service users for their input as their inputs will reflect on our grade for our service. We really need everyone's thoughts and inputs as without our user's involvement we will not be able to achieve higher grades.
